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
81318294 90295357426 7050405
06856524982 4396
06856524982 4396
61110939532 3906 802
All about undefined
Interested in learning more?
06856524982 4396
61110939532 3906 802
See more
92480 596391699 25196088173
9920851 7999 47 34590746 7963739
See more
19457637807 51139
4142466 6260264 2382
See more